基于大数据的检验检测信息化平台设计

摘要 传统检测机构产品送检流程复杂,产品检测单一化,检测实验数据不能及时处理。设计采用大数据架构整合检验检测机构资源,结合互联网技术、无线通信技术、自动化技术和OCR技术实现送检产品线上填报,实验室仪器无线连接通信形成网络无线通信网络,检测产品生成的PDF格式数据利用OCR技术结合Python脚本自动化上传特征数据至云端平台,云端平台根据提供的数据源重新组合制作出产品报告。平台运作之后线上操作无需前台等待送检,实验室检测数据及时上传平台,送检人随时关注产品信息。保证数据的准确性,实时性和可靠性,可提升检测机构的办公效率和公信度。 The traditional testing organization's product inspection process is complex,product testingis simple,and testing experimental data can not be processed in time.This paper uses resources from big data architecture integration,inspection and testing institutions,and,through the Internet technology,wireless communication technology,automation technology and OCR technology,realizes online forwarding of inspected products,laboratory instrument wireless communication forming a network of wireless communication network,testing products generated PDF format data using OCR technology combined with the feature of Python scripts for automatic uploading characteristic data to the cloud platform,and the cloud platform rearranging and making product reports using the data source provided.After the operation of the platform,there is no need for the online operation to wait at the front desk for inspection.The laboratory test data will be uploaded to the platform in time,and the inspection sender will pay attention to the product information at any time.Ensuring the accuracy,real-time and reliability of data can improve the office efficiency and credibility of testing institutions.
